pooliot-client
Version:
45 lines (28 loc) • 1.09 kB
JavaScript
require('nightingale-app-console');
var _alpNode = require('alp-node');
var _alpNode2 = _interopRequireDefault(_alpNode);
var _alpLimosa = require('alp-limosa');
var _alpLimosa2 = _interopRequireDefault(_alpLimosa);
var _alpBodyParser = require('alp-body-parser');
var _alpBodyParser2 = _interopRequireDefault(_alpBodyParser);
var _routerBuilder = require('./routerBuilder');
var _routerBuilder2 = _interopRequireDefault(_routerBuilder);
var _controllers = require('./modules/controllers');
var _controllers2 = _interopRequireDefault(_controllers);
function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}
if (!process.send) {
// eslint-disable-next-line no-console
console.log('Not forked.');
process.exit(1);
}
const app = new _alpNode2.default();
// init / config
(0, _alpBodyParser2.default)(app);
app.catchErrors();
app.servePublic();
app.use((0, _alpLimosa2.default)(_routerBuilder2.default, _controllers2.default)(app));
app.start(async () => {
await app.listen();
});
//# sourceMappingURL=index.js.map
;